题目内容

从产品表Products中查询前10行商品的单价UnitPrice之和,正确的SQL是()

A. SELECT TOP 10 SUM(UnitPrice) AS单价之和FROM Products
B. SELECT SUM(UnitPrice) AS单价之和TOP 10 FROM Products
C. SELECT TOP 10 COUNT(UnitPrice) AS单价之和FROM Products
D. SELECT SUM(UnitPrice) TOP 10 AS单价之和FROM Products

查看答案
更多问题

Student表中所有电话号码(列名:telephone)的第一位为8或6,第三位为0的电话号码( )。

A. SELECT telephone FROM student WHERE telephone LIKE '[8,6]%0*'
B. SELECT telephone FROM student WHERE telephone LIKE '(8,6)*0%'
C. SELECT telephone FROM student WHERE telephone LIKE '[8,6]_0%'
D. SELECT telephone FROM student WHERE telephone LIKE '[8,6]_0*'

现有学生成绩表Student_info,其中包括姓名(stu_name),学号(stu_id),成绩(stu_grade)。我们需要查询成绩为80分的学生姓名,要求结果按照学号降序排列。下面查询语句正确的是( )。

A. SELECT stu_name FROM student_info Where stu_grade=80 ORDER BY stu_id ASC
B. SELECT stu_name FROM student_info WHERE stu_grade=80 ORDER BY stu_id DESC
C. SELECT stu_id,stu_name FROM student_info WHERE stu_grade=80 ORDER BY stu_name ASC
D. SELECT stu_name FROM student_info WHERE stu_grade LIKE 80 ORDER BY stu_id DESC

在数据库中,要防止小于100的数保存到UnisInStock列,可以( )。

A. 使用主键约束
B. 使用缺省约束
C. 使用外键约束
D. 使用检查约束

在数据表中,若存在标识列,下列说法正确的是( )。

A. 在Insert语句中,当它不存在,该列的值将自动增长
B. 在Update语句中,一样可以更改
C. 在使用Select 语句查询时将看不见标识列
D. 使用Delete 语句删除不了所有数据

答案查题题库